1. The All-Around Workhorse

A Masterclass in Balanced Design: This category defines the perfect intersection of performance, durability, and accessible pricing that retail buyers dream of stocking. The 2026 trend centers on fully-machined, large arbor reels featuring powerful, sealed carbon-fiber drag systems that deliver flagship performance without the premium price tag. Visually, these reels showcase clean, classic designs with matte anodized finishes in versatile colors like charcoal and bronze. The large arbor spool design maximizes line retrieval speed while the sealed drag provides consistent pressure from delicate trout streams to light saltwater flats. This is the reel that retailers can confidently recommend to a majority of customers, making it a cornerstone product for any serious tackle shop’s inventory strategy.

3. The Saltwater Fortress

The Indestructible Sealed Drag: Engineered specifically for the most corrosive environments, these reels represent the pinnacle of sealed drag technology in 2026. The defining innovation is the completely enclosed, multi-stack carbon fiber and stainless steel drag system that remains impervious to sand, salt, and moisture. Visual design emphasizes strength and reliability through robust construction details—oversized drag adjustment knobs for easy operation with wet hands, reinforced frame joints, and military-grade anodizing in colors like tactical olive and gunmetal. Close inspection reveals the precision-machined sealing surfaces and heavy-duty O-rings that make these systems bombproof. This category appeals to serious saltwater anglers pursuing tarpon and permit, while providing product developers with a clear template for premium, specialized fishing reel design that can command top-tier pricing.

5. The Heritage Revival

A Modern Click-and-Pawl: Tapping into powerful nostalgia trends, this category brings the classic click-and-pawl drag system into the modern era through precision engineering and contemporary materials. While lacking the raw stopping power of disc drags, these reels deliver an unmatched tactile and auditory experience that traditionalists cherish—the iconic buzzing sound as fish make their runs. The 2026 versions feature lightweight, CNC-machined construction with updated pawl mechanisms that provide smooth, reliable operation while maintaining that classic acoustic signature. Visual design balances heritage aesthetics with modern manufacturing quality, often featuring exposed gear trains and traditional color schemes in forest green or classic black. This trend demonstrates how emotional connection and experiential value can create profitable niche markets, offering retailers a way to differentiate from purely performance-focused competitors.

9. The Large Arbor Speedster

Maximum Retrieval Rate: Function drives every design decision in these extreme large arbor reels that prioritize maximum line retrieval speed for fast-moving saltwater species like bonefish and false albacore. The oversized spool diameter enables unprecedented pickup rates, while aggressive porting patterns minimize weight despite the increased size. Visual design is unapologetically functional, featuring massive handles for positive grip and extensively perforated spools that create distinctive geometric patterns. The aesthetic communicates serious performance intent through robust construction details and purposeful proportions that signal specialized capability. These reels represent the ultimate expression of form-following-function philosophy, appealing to technical anglers who prioritize performance over traditional aesthetics. For product developers, this category demonstrates how extreme optimization for specific use cases can create compelling differentiation and justify premium pricing in specialized market segments.
